Established in 1899 and headquartered in Savannah, Georgia, South University is a non-profit institution offering degree programs. The institution consists of a school of pharmacy, college of nursing and public health, college of health professions, college of business, college of theology, and college of arts and sciences.

Founded in 1964, Cleveland State University is a public research institution. It offers degrees in the fields of business, education and human services, engineering, liberal arts, and social sciences, science, and urban affairs, as well as undergraduate and graduate programs. The company is head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io.
